The EuroMillions offers a massive jackpot of R3.1 billion with draws occurring on Tuesday and Friday. The EuroMillions jackpots got even bigger as part of the major changes took place from the 1st of February 2020. The previous prize cap stood at €190 million (approx. R3,821,321,877) and had reached this cap four times since it was last set in July 2011. Under the new rules, the prize cap will now increase by €10 million (approx. R201,122,204) and will now stand at €200 million (approx. R4,022,444,082).

MegaMillions now offers a big jackpot of R1.3 billion with draws occurring on Wednesday and Saturday. During the year a total of 2 lucky ticket holders won the Mega Millions top prize. The one winner won a total of $123 million (approx. R2,056,547,700) and another winner took home a $202 million (approx. R3,377,419,800) prize. There has already been a total of 4 Mega Millions jackpot winners this year.

The US Powerball now offers a jackpot of R936 million with draws occurring on Thursday and Sunday. The US Powerball offers massive prize amounts; the highest US Powerball top prize has reached an amount of R26 billion.

The SuperEnaLotto offers players a jackpot amount of R652,4 million with draws occurring on Tuesday, Thursday and Saturday. The lotto holds the record for the largest jackpot paid out in Europe, the single winning ticket collecting €209.1 million (approx. R4,185,800,190).

The EuroJackpot offers a big jackpot of R200 million with draws occurring on Friday. The biggest ever EuroJackpot top prize is €90 million (approx. R1,803,015,000) and has been won on many occasions. The reason why the amount has only reached €90 million is because of the jackpot cap.
